write.h

来自「这是lcd驱动程序」· C头文件 代码 · 共 58 行

H
58
字号

void LCD_writeline(uchar xx,uchar yy,uint n)
{
	uint p;
	uchar x,y;
//	p=ch1*16;
	p=n;
	 for(x=0+xx;x<2+xx;x++){
		for(y=0+yy;y<8+yy;y++){
			lcd_setxyaddr(x,y);
			if(y<64){
				lcd_senddata(1, Asc16[p]);
			}
			else{
				lcd_senddata(2, Asc16[p]);
			}
			p++;			
		}
	}
}
void LCD_write(void)
{
	uint p;
	uchar x,y;
	p=0;
	for(y=0;y<90;y++){
	 for(x=0;x<8;x++){
	//	for(y=0;y<90;y++){
			lcd_setxyaddr(x,y);
			if(y<64){
				lcd_senddata(1,  bmp[p]);
			}
			else{
				lcd_senddata(2,  bmp[p]);
			}
			p++;			
		}
	}
}
void LCD_pig(void)
{
	uint p;
	uchar x,y;
	p=0;
	for(y=0;y<86;y++){
	 for(x=0;x<8;x++){
			lcd_setxyaddr(x,y);
			if(y<64){
				lcd_senddata(1,  pig[p]);
			}
			else{
				lcd_senddata(2,  pig[p]);
			}
			p++;			
		}
	}
}

⌨️ 快捷键说明

复制代码Ctrl + C
搜索代码Ctrl + F
全屏模式F11
增大字号Ctrl + =
减小字号Ctrl + -
显示快捷键?